The power outage
symbol, appears in
the display and the
alarm sounds.
The temperature display
will show the warmest
temperature recorded in
the freezer during a
power outage or an
interruption to the
power supply.
There is a power outage: The temperature in the
appliance over the last few days or hours has risen
too high because of a power outage or interruption to
the power supply.
The appliance will go back to the last temperature
setting when the power is restored.
Press the alarm off sensor button.
The warmest temperature displayed will disappear.
The display will then revert to showing the current
temperature in the Freezer Zone.
Depending on the temperature displayed, you
should check whether food in the freezer has
started to thaw or has defrosted. If it has, cook it
before freezing it again.

The symbol has lit up
on the display and the
appliance is not cooling
although the controls
and the interior lighting
are working.
Demo mode is on. This allows the appliance to be
presented in the showroom without the cooling
system being switched on. Do not activate this setting
for domestic use.
Turn off demo mode (see “Information for dealers -
Demo mode”).
